The FiiO q5s is currently $299 on amazon. It's one of the more powerful portable DAC/Amps. The hip dac from IFI is $150 currently too. Did you get the argons with the option to go balanced or is it the standard single ended only? The Q5s does 220mW single ended and the Hip dac from ifi does 280mW. The q5s does let you swap modules out and if you're running single ended only then you can get their AM5 module that does 500mW off single ended. Those are getting harder to find these days but the Q5s gives you some flexibility. I had the ZMF classics which are also a t50rp modded headphone like the argons and they definitely need more power to sound close to a desktop amp.

I would just use the stock amp the Q5s comes with. It can push out 560mW via the balanced connection. Would say go THX module if you wanna try it but the stock module is perfectly fine. The stock one squeezes a little more power than the THX one too.

I haven't tried the hip dac personally but I know there was alot of hype when it launched. I imagine it will be fine but I like smaller devices and the Q5s is small enough that I don't get irritated carrying it around If I forget my dap at home or If I'm gonna use it with my laptop at work.

Are you gonna be connecting to a source with the portable DAC/Amp via an aux cord? Or will you be going bluetooth/usb? I only ask cause at under $500 you could always buy a good dap like the Fiio m11 or hiby R5/r6 pro. My Fiio M11 pushes about the same power as my Q5s and sounds the same but It allows me to save battery on my iphone. It doesn't allow line in via aux though so I use the Q5s for my switch and anything else that wont let me go usb. If you need a line in via aux then at least the two daps I mentioned are useless.
